SYMBOL INDEX (48 symbols across 4 files) FILE: src/Backpropagation/Algorithm/Connection.java class Connection (line 3) | class Connection { method Connection (line 13) | Connection(Neuron fromN) { method getWeight (line 19) | double getWeight() { method setWeight (line 23) | void setWeight(double w) { method setBestWeight (line 27) | void setBestWeight(double w) { method setWeightAsBest (line 31) | void setWeightAsBest() { method setDeltaWeight (line 35) | void setDeltaWeight(double w) { method getPrevDeltaWeight (line 40) | double getPrevDeltaWeight() { method getLeftNeuron (line 44) | Neuron getLeftNeuron() { FILE: src/Backpropagation/Algorithm/NeuralNetwork.java class NeuralNetwork (line 5) | public class NeuralNetwork { method NeuralNetwork (line 18) | public NeuralNetwork(ArrayList inputs, ArrayList out... method getRandomNumber (line 79) | private Double getRandomNumber(Double minRange, Double maxRange) { method setInput (line 83) | private void setInput(Double inputs[]) { method getOutput (line 89) | private Double[] getOutput() { method activate (line 96) | private void activate() { method applyBackpropagation (line 105) | private void applyBackpropagation(Double expectedOutput[]) { method run (line 162) | public String run(int maxSteps, double minError) { method test (line 228) | public String test(ArrayList inputs, int maxSteps, double mi... method getOutputKind (line 259) | public int[] getOutputKind(ArrayList inputs, int maxSteps, d... method printAllWeights (line 290) | private void printAllWeights() { method printWeights (line 296) | private void printWeights(Neuron n) { FILE: src/Backpropagation/Algorithm/Neuron.java class Neuron (line 5) | class Neuron { method Neuron (line 13) | Neuron() { method calculateOutput (line 18) | void calculateOutput() { method sigmoid (line 29) | private double sigmoid(double x) { method addConnections (line 33) | void addConnections(ArrayList neurons) { method addConnections (line 41) | void addConnections(Neuron[] neurons) { method getConnection (line 49) | Connection getConnection(int neuronIndex) { method getAllConnections (line 53) | ArrayList getAllConnections() { method getOutput (line 57) | double getOutput() { method setOutput (line 61) | void setOutput(double o) { FILE: src/Backpropagation/MainFrame.java class MainFrame (line 25) | public class MainFrame { method MainFrame (line 74) | private MainFrame() { method loadFile (line 326) | private void loadFile(JFileChooser fileChooser) { method resetData (line 375) | private void resetData() { method initialData (line 386) | private void initialData() { method startTrain (line 415) | private void startTrain(ArrayList inputs) { method round (line 427) | private Double round(Double value, int places) { method normalize (line 434) | private Double normalize(Double input, Double min, Double max) { method convertCoordinate (line 438) | private Double[] convertCoordinate(Double[] oldPoint) { method alertBackground (line 445) | private void alertBackground(JTextField textField, boolean alert) { method resetFrame (line 452) | private static void resetFrame() { method changeLAF (line 458) | private static void changeLAF(String name) { method createUIComponents (line 475) | private void createUIComponents() { method main (line 483) | public static void main(String[] args) { class GPanel (line 540) | private class GPanel extends JPanel { method paintComponent (line 541) | @Override method drawScale (line 600) | private void drawScale(Graphics2D g2, Double i) {